FAWKES, JOHN JOSEPH "JACK," 80, of
Zephyrhills, died Wednesday (Aug. 13, 2003) at James A. Haley VA Medical
Center in Tampa. Born in Winnipeg, Canada, he came to Florida in 1980. He
was a construction superintendent.
He was an Army veteran of World War II,
serving as a paratrooper in the 82nd Airborne.
He belonged to the Two Rivers Hunt and was
chairman of the Gold Coast Terrier Network. He was Catholic.
Survivors include his wife, Pauline; five
daughters, Pauline Atkinson and Frances Shiver, both of Zephyrhills,
Margaret Brower, Kingston, N.Y., Dolores Fawkes, Atlanta, and Maryann
Jacobsen, Middleton, Md.; two sons, John Fawkes Jr., Barington, Ill., and
David Fawkes, Davie; a sister, Freda Rigsbee, Tampa; 10 grandchildren; and a
great-granddaughter. Whitfield Funeral Home, Zephyrhills.
